    Posted by Jonathan Lewis on March 21, 2009 at 9:07 pm

    Alright this is really strange and Im not sure whats going on. I have started a new AE project and the lights are not registering. I am using CS4. Everything is perfect, 3D layers, material option set to accept lights, that stuff is fine. They are simply not working. I opened an older project with active lights and those work fine.

    Got it now from a helpful soul. It’s the Draft 3D feature, which is a few buttons to the right of the search bar on the timeline.

    Also, have layer controls selected (Ctrl/cmd + shift = H). Wasn’t my problem in this case, but also important.
